Grasping Registered Agents in the State of Washington

A registered agent in Washington is a specific entity or organization that stands in for a corporation in receiving important legal papers, such as tax forms, official correspondence, and process serving. This responsibility is crucial for preserving good standing with the state and guaranteeing that a business can effectively respond to legal actions and other legal notifications. Having a dependable registered agent ensures that your business is aware and can take timely action in compliance with legal requirements.

In the State of Washington, any business entity, including firms and limited liability companies, must appoint a registered agent when creating their company. This registered agent must have a real address in the State of Washington, as P.O. boxes are not acceptable. The agent can be an person resident in the state or a corporation authorized to operate in Washington. This ensures that legal papers can be sent promptly and accurately.

Selecting the right registered agent in the State of Washington can greatly impact your operations. It is crucial to pick someone who is responsive, organized, and familiar with the legal laws in the state. Inability to maintain a up-to-date registered agent can cause consequences, including loss of good standing or having automatic judgments rendered against the business. Therefore, comprehending the function and responsibilities of registered agents is crucial for any business owner.

Benefits of Having a Registered Agent

Employing a registered representative in the state of Washington gives business owners with a trustworthy source of communication for important legal and tax documents. This secures that vital communications, such as service of process and state correspondence, are received promptly and processed in a efficient manner. By designating a registered agent, businesses can prevent missing critical deadlines and possible legal issues that could arise from an oversight.

An additional key benefit of having a Washington registered agent is the confidentiality it offers. When a business has a registered agent, the agent's location is recorded publicly instead of the owner's residential address or commercial address. LLC registered agent supports maintain the owner's privacy and defends them from unsolicited solicitations, as well as maintaining their personal information safe from public view.

Additionally, a registered agent can elevate a company's credibility and professionalism. Partners may feel more confident knowing that a business has a committed registered agent. This demonstrates responsibility and compliance with state regulations, building trust and reliability within a challenging marketplace.

Cost Considerations for Registered Agents

When it comes to a registered agent in Washington, it is crucial to be aware of the multiple costs involved. Most registered agents charge a flat annual fee for their services, which can vary significantly depending on the level of service provided. Basic packages may cost around fifty to a hundred dollars annually, while advanced packages, which offer additional features like document forwarding and compliance reminders, can go up to several hundreds dollars.

In addition of the service fee, consider potential hidden costs that may arise. Some registered agents might charge extra for handling documents, providing expedited service, or if you need additional assistance with compliance and state filings. It is crucial to clarify all potential fees during your initial discussions so that you are aware by unexpected charges later on.

Lastly, while price is an important factor, it should not be the sole consideration. A registered agent's reputation, customer service quality, and reliability are also vital components that affect your business’s legality and operational efficiency. Balancing costs with the level of service and support provided will help you choose the right Washington registered agent for your needs.
